Exactly How to Install Roof Covering Racks: A Detailed Overview

Setting up a roofing shelf on your automobile can look like a difficult job, but with the best directions and devices, it's a straightforward process. Roof covering racks supply valuable added storage area, making them an excellent enhancement for carrying bikes, baggage, kayaks, and much more. In this in-depth guide, we'll walk you with the detailed procedure of installing roofing system shelfs, ensuring a protected and reliable configuration.

Tools Needed:

Prior to you start, gather the complying with devices and materials:

Roofing rack set (consists of bars, mounting brackets, and equipment).
Screwdriver (Phillips and flathead).
Wrench or socket collection.
Gauging tape.
Lube (if needed).
Level.
Detailed Guidelines:.

Read the Directions:.
Beginning by thoroughly reading the producer's instructions that included your roofing rack set. Each system may have particular setup requirements or recommendations.

Prepare Your Car:.
Ensure your vehicle's roof is clean and devoid of particles. If your automobile has factory-installed rails or crossbars, you might require to remove or change them prior to installing the new roof covering shelf.

Set Up the Mounting Braces:.
Many roof covering racks need installing brackets to protect the crossbars to your automobile's roof covering. Position the brackets according to the guidelines, usually aligning them with the manufacturing facility installing points or door frames.

Tip: Use a gauging tape to make sure the brackets are equally spaced and lined up. This assists distribute the load equally throughout the roofing system.
Attach the Crossbars:.
As soon as the mounting braces are in place, position the crossbars on top of them. Ensure the bars are aligned and degree. Many roof rack systems have flexible bars, enabling you to customize the spacing.

Idea: Utilize a level to inspect that the bars are even. This guarantees that the roof rack operates properly and lowers wind resistance.
Safeguard the Crossbars:.
Fasten the bars to the mounting braces using the supplied equipment. Tighten the screws or screws securely, however be cautious not to overtighten, as this can damage the braces or your vehicle's roofing.

Tip: If your roofing rack set consists of locking devices, mount them to prevent theft and make certain the crossbars stay firmly in position.
Inspect the Placement:.
After installing the bars, double-check their positioning and guarantee they are degree. Adjust if needed to make sure correct functionality and security.

Affix Accessories:.
If you intend to utilize added accessories such as bike racks or cargo boxes, connect them to the bars according to the manufacturer's instructions. Guarantee that all devices are firmly fastened and correctly changed.

Execute a Safety And Security Check:.
Before using your roof covering shelf, execute a last safety check. Make sure all screws, screws, and add-ons are tightened properly. Make sure that the crossbars and devices are protected and secure.

Tip: It's a great idea to evaluate the roofing system rack with a light tons before bring larger products. This aids make certain that every little thing is firmly mounted.
Safety and security Tips:.

Examine Weight Purviews:.
Validate the weight ability of both the roofing shelf and your lorry's roofing. Prevent exceeding these limitations to guarantee security during travel.

Normal Upkeep:.
Regularly inspect the roofing system rack and accessories for damage. Tighten up any type of loose components and evaluate for any kind of indications of damage.

Be Mindful of Height:.
Remember that a roof racks perth roofing system rack adds height to your vehicle. Beware of low-clearance locations such as parking garages or drive-thrus.
